Abstract

Official abstract text for this publication.

In order to provide a method for hardening a metal sheet material by means of which a particularly hard and scratch-resistant surface is produced on the metal sheet material, it is proposed that the method comprises the following: applying at least one peening stream to the metal sheet material, wherein at least one peening stream is applied to a front side of the metal sheet material and/or a rear side of the metal sheet material, respectively.

The invention claimed is: 1. A metal sheet material comprising a front side which is surface-hardened by peening and a rear side which is surface-hardened by peening, wherein the metal sheet material is a stainless steel sheet material comprising 8% to 10.5% by weight of nickel, wherein the material thickness of the metal sheet material is not more than 1.5 mm and wherein the metal sheet material has a mean final surface hardness of at least 300 HV. 2. The metal sheet material according to claim 1 , wherein the metal sheet material has a matt surface. 3. A metal sheet product, which is configured as a kitchen worktop panel, a sink or a basin and comprises a metal sheet material comprising a front side which is surface-hardened by peening and a rear side which is surface-hardened by peening, wherein the metal sheet material is a stainless steel sheet material comprising 8% to 10.5% by weight of nickel, wherein the material thickness of the metal sheet material is not more than 1.5 mm and wherein the metal sheet material has a mean final surface hardness of at least 300 HV. 4. The metal sheet material according to claim 1 , wherein the stainless steel sheet material comprises the stainless steel with the material number 1.4301 in accordance with EN 10027-2. 5. The metal sheet material according to claim 1 , wherein the metal sheet material has a mean final surface hardness of at least approximately 400 HV. 6. The metal sheet product according to claim 3 , wherein the stainless steel sheet material comprises the stainless steel with the material number 1.4301 in accordance with EN 10027-2. 7. The metal sheet product according to claim 3 , wherein the metal sheet material has a mean final surface hardness of at least 400 HV. 8. The metal sheet product according to claim 3 , wherein the metal sheet material has a matt surface. 9. A method of forming a sheet metal product, comprising: providing a metal sheet material as a starting material, wherein the metal sheet material comprises a front side which is surface-hardened by peening and a rear side which is surface-hardened by peening, wherein the metal sheet material is a stainless steel sheet material comprising 8% to 10.5% by weight of nickel, wherein the material thickness of the metal sheet material is not more than 1.5 mm and wherein the metal sheet material has a mean final surface hardness of at least 300 HV; and manufacturing a kitchen worktop panel, a sink or a basin from said starting material.
